    The NewTek 3Play 440 is around 25K and great value. The Zeplay, if im not mistaken, is around 70K. Am not sure about the Mira, but i’ve sen the 3Play in action and seems to be really good. Also, it’s pretty easy to learn to operate.

    January 13, 2015 at 6:27 am in reply to: D600, Does it output 422?

    A lot of DSLRs and mirrorless cameras output 4:2:0 through HDMI. I usually use GH4s as it outputs 10 bit 4:2:2 to the external recorders. If I’m not mistaken. the D600 outputs 8 bit 4:2:2.
